What it's like to attend

Children are happy and eager to learn at this nursery. They form close relationships with staff and seek comfort from them, feeling comfortable and safe. Children of all ages are challenged in their learning, developing early literacy skills and fostering their imagination and love of reading.

Inspector highlights

  • Children are happy and eager to learn.
  • Children of all ages are challenged in their learning, with learning progressing over time.
  • Children with special education needs and/or disabilities are supported to make good progress.
  • Mathematical language is embedded well.
  • Children's independence is promoted.

Areas to develop

  • 1provide clear and consistent messages for children to support their understanding of boundaries and what is expected of them
  • 2monitor staff practice more closely to identify strengths and weakness in their practice, so that adequate support can be put into place.

Inclusion & environment

How they support every child

SEND provision

Children with special education needs and/or disabilities are supported to make good progress in their learning. Staff know children well, which enables them to meet children's individual needs. Objects of reference are used to support children's understanding of the daily routine.

Outdoor space

Children use timers to help them learn to take turns on outdoor equipment. Outside, babies have a separate area which gives them a safe environment to explore.
